WebWhat does the symbol (aq) represent in a chemical equation ? Solution In a chemical equation, the subscript (aq) after a molecule means that it is aqueous. WebOct 2, 2024 · Balance the chemical equation. Write the equation in terms of all of the ions in the solution. In other words, break all of the strong electrolytes into the ions they form in aqueous solution. Often, it's important to know the physical state of a reactant or product. WebTo indicate physical state of a chemical, a symbol in parentheses may be appended to its formula: (s) for a solid, (l) for a liquid, (g) for a gas, and (aq) for an aqueous solution.
